Tuesday, July 14, 2026- Poison drummer Rikki Rockett has revealed that he refused doctors' recommendation to amputate part of his tongue during his battle with oral cancer, choosing instead to pursue treatment that offered a chance to preserve his ability to speak and maintain his quality of life.
His decision came after carefully weighing the risks and seeking alternative medical opinions, highlighting the importance of making informed healthcare choices alongside qualified specialists.
Rockett's experience shines a light on the difficult decisions many cancer patients face when balancing survival with long-term quality of life.
